Central was not able to break out of their rough patch on Friday as the team picked up their sixth straight loss. They fell 3-1 to the Madera South Stallions. The Grizzlies were not able to repeat the success they had when they faced the Stallions earlier this season, when they won 3-0.
The match finished with set scores of 25-10, 25-19, 12-25, 25-12.
Multiple players turned in solid performances to lead Madera South to victory, but perhaps none more so than Allysson Daza, who had 20 digs and eight aces. Those 20 digs gave Daza a new career-high. The team also got some help courtesy of Isabella Zaragosa, who had 16 kills, four aces, and three blocks.
Central's defeat dropped their record down to 2-12. As for Madera South, the win (which was their fourth in a row) raised their record to 8-21.
Coming up, Central will challenge Torres at 6:00 p.m. on Monday. As for Madera South, they will take on Sunnyside at 5:30 p.m. on Tuesday.
